RESOLUTION NO.2003- 092
A R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F
IN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A, CANCELING TAXES UPON
PUBLICLY OWNED LANDS, PURSUANT TO SECTION 196.28
FLORIDA STATUTES.
WHEREAS, Section 196.28, Florida Statutes, allows the Board of County Commissioners of each
County to cancel and discharge any and all liens for taxes, delinquent or current, held or owned by the
county or the state, upon lands heretofore or hereafter conveyed to or acquired by any agency,
governmental subdivision, or municipality of the state, or the United States, for road purposes, defense
purposes, recreation, reforestation, or other public use; and
WHEREAS, such cancellation must be by resolution of the Board of County Commissioners, duly
adopted and entered upon its minutes properly describing such lands and setting forth the public use to
which the same are or will be devoted; and
WHEREAS, upon receipt of a certified copy of such resolution, proper officials of the county and
of the state are authorized, empowered and directed to make proper entries upon the records to
accomplish such cancellation and to do all things necessary to carry out the provisions of Section 196.28,
F.S.;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F
IN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A, that:
• The property described on attached Exhibit "A" is hereby accepted and any and all liens for taxes,
delinquent or current, against the property described in OR Book 1619, Page 2433 which was
recently acquired by Indian River County for future right of way are hereby canceled, pursuant to the
authority of Section 196.28, F.S.
• The Clerk to the Board of County Commissioners is hereby directed to send a certified copy of this
resolution to the Tax Collector and the Property Appraiser.
